you are not in itBased on current offerings, here are the leading governed "Slurm-as-a-Service" platforms worth evaluating for enterprise AI scheduling:
1. CoreWeave SUNK (Slurm on Kubernetes)
CoreWeave's platform runs
Slurm as the user-facing scheduler while Kubernetes provides namespaces and Pod substrate, with shared storage and networking tuned around AI training and HPC-style batch execution
. Its differentiator is governance-friendly usability:
researcher-friendly access, automated user provisioning, dedicated environments, and mixed Slurm plus Kubernetes operation, with a self-service direction that reduces admin bottlenecks and lowers the Kubernetes knowledge required from end users
. See coreweave.com
2. Crusoe Managed Slurm (on Crusoe Managed Kubernetes)
Crusoe abstracts away the operational burden of Slurm —
provisioning compute nodes, configuring shared filesystems, managing user identity across every node, validating GPU health, and keeping the whole thing running through hardware failures and software updates
— delivering it as a governed managed service. It's built on SchedMD's own Kubernetes integration project. See crusoe.ai
3. NVIDIA/SchedMD Slinky on Kubernetes
For enterprises wanting a vendor-neutral, self-hosted governed layer, Slinky (from SchedMD, now part of NVIDIA) lets teams
integrate with the NVIDIA GPU Operator and DRA/ComputeDomains for automated GPU management and topology-aware multinode scheduling, with production deployments scaling to over 8,000 GPUs and maintaining unified observability via Prometheus and Grafana
. See developer.nvidia.com
4. Red Hat OpenShift AI (Slurm + OpenShift)
For enterprises needing strict governance/compliance overlays, Red Hat's approach lets
HPC researchers who submit jobs via sbatch keep their existing workflow, but running inside OpenShift now with all the observability, lifecycle management, and governance that Kubernetes provides
. See redhat.com
5. Tata Communications AI Cloud
Combines
Slurm GPU scheduling with the scalability and agility of Kubernetes, delivered via dedicated BareMetal GPUs for training, deploying, and scaling AI models efficiently and securely
. See tatacommunications.com
Governance note: Since NVIDIA's acquisition of SchedMD, some analysts flag a
"strategic dependency risk"
around vendor control of the scheduler—worth factoring into procurement/governance decisions (infoworld.com).
